User Experience and Use Cases: Putting it to Work
How you’ll use a ‘Dr For Diabetes’ product is a big part of choosing the right one.
- Daily Blood Glucose Monitoring: Glucose meters and test strips are used multiple times a day to check sugar levels.
- Continuous Glucose Monitoring (CGM): Sensors worn on the body provide real-time glucose readings, helping you understand trends and make informed decisions about food, exercise, and medication.
- Medication Management: Insulin pens, syringes, and pill organizers help you take your diabetes medications correctly and on schedule.
- Diet and Nutrition Tools: Apps or smart scales can help you track your food intake and understand how different foods affect your blood sugar.
- Foot Care: Special socks or lotions can help prevent common diabetes-related foot problems.

Q: What is the difference between a glucose meter and a CGM?
A: A glucose meter gives you a snapshot of your blood sugar at a single point in time. A CGM provides continuous readings throughout the day and night, showing trends.
Q: Do ‘Dr For Diabetes’ products require a prescription?
A: Some products, like certain insulin pumps or CGMs, may require a prescription. Others, like basic glucose meters or pill organizers, are often available over-the-counter.
